The PO2 Craig Blake Memorial Fitness Challenge offers military and DND personnel an exhilarating opportunity to participate in a sprint triathlon. The race consists of three challenging segments: a 300m swim, followed by a 6.5K mountain bike ride, and concluding with a 2K run. Athletes can choose to compete individually or as part of a relay team. This event is dedicated to the memory of PO2 Craig Blake, an avid cyclist and triathlete who was tragically the first Royal Canadian Navy sailor to lose his life in Afghanistan while serving his country.
